People also ask, what was the biggest hit of the 90s?

The song "One Sweet Day", performed by Mariah Carey and Boyz II Men, had 16 weeks on top of the chart, and became the longest-running number-one song in history, until surpassed in 2019 by "Old Town Road".

What was the #1 song in 1991?

Billboard Year-End Hot 100 singles of 1991
No.TitleArtist(s)
1"(Everything I Do) I Do It for You"Bryan Adams
2"I Wanna Sex You Up"Color Me Badd
3"Gonna Make You Sweat (Everybody Dance Now)"C+C Music Factory
4"Rush Rush"Paula Abdul

What was the #1 song of 1995?

Billboard Year-End Hot 100 singles of 1995
TitleArtist(s)
1"Gangsta's Paradise"Coolio featuring L.V.
2"Waterfalls"TLC
3"Creep"TLC
4"Kiss from a Rose"Seal

Who was the most famous singer in 1990?

Mariah Carey was declared the Artist of the Decade of the 1990s by Billboard.
